Today’s Scripture: And Joanna the wife of Chuza Herod’s steward, and Susanna, and many others, which ministered unto him of their substance. Luke 8:3 KJB
We all have something to help bring the Good News to others. This is our “ministry”.
We can serve our Lord and others by giving what we have. Luke 8:1-3 brings to light the many people and gifts that help bring the Good News to others.
In Luke 8:1 Jesus was travelling through cities and villages proclaiming and bringing the Good News of the Kingdom of God. The twelve disciples were with Him too yet how often we overlook verses two and three. Also with them were women who had been healed of evil spirits and infirmities that ministered to them out of their substance.
What substance do you and I have to minister with? Do we have testimonies? Do we have other means of supporting the Good News of the Kingdom of God? Our ministry is to give what we have.
What do you have to give today?
